Weather in April

April in Yei is characterized by a distinct increase in downpour as the wet season settles in. The city transitions under the increasing cloud cover, casting softer shadows. As the showers increase, residents and visitors adapt their schedules to enjoy the intermittent sunshine. The wind speed levels out, providing a slight relief from the increasing humidity. The rainfall quadruples from the previous month, with 109mm (4.29") raining on an average of 21.5 days.

Temperature

April's climate in Yei, South Sudan, shows a minor adjustment in average high-temperatures to a moderately hot 29.7°C (85.5°F) from March's 32.3°C (90.1°F). Throughout April, an average low-temperature of 19.3°C (66.7°F) is experienced.

Heat index

For most parts of April, the heat index is computed to be a hot 34°C (93.2°F). Ensure heightened precautions, risk of heat cramps and heat exhaustion is significant. Sustained activity could provoke heatstroke.
When assessing, remember that heat index measurements are for light winds and shaded spots. With exposure to direct sunshine, the heat index could climb by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'apparent temperature' or 'feels like', joins air temperature with relative humidity to produce a temperature perception for humans. One's perception of temperature is subjective, varying based on their activity and individual heat perception, influenced by factors like wind, clothing, and metabolic variations. Direct sun rays can make one feel hotter, potentially raising the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are extremely significant for babies and toddlers. Young individuals are generally in more danger than adults due to their lower capacity to sweat. Moreover, their large skin surface in relation to their small bodies and the increased heat generation from their activities makes them more vulnerable.

Humidity

In April, the average relative humidity is 70%.

Rainfall

In Yei, in April, it is raining for 21.5 days, with typically 109mm (4.29") of accumulated precipitation. In Yei, South Sudan, during the entire year, the rain falls for 235.5 days and collects up to 1389mm (54.69") of precipitation.

Daylight

In Yei, the average length of the day in April is 12h and 13min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 05:56 and sunset at 18:05. On the last day of April, in Yei, sunrise is at 05:46 and sunset at 18:02 CAT.

Sunshine

In Yei, South Sudan, the average sunshine in April is 9h.

UV index

In April, the average daily maximum UV index is 6. A UV Index value of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high health risk from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for average individuals.
Note: An average UV index of 6 in April transforms into this advice:
Guard oneself from overexposure. Defence against sun injury is vital. Stay in the shade and avoid direct Sun exposure from 10 a.m. to 4 p.m., a period when UV radiation is particularly strong, noting that parasols or canopies may not offer total sun protection. A hat with a broad brim is indispensable, filtering out up to half of UV rays.
